Kim Jong Un sends a message to Joe Biden: You've made a big mistake

Kim Jong Un sends a message to Joe Biden: You've made a big mistake

North Korea has called American diplomacy “false” and has rejected the negotiation bid with Washington today. The statement comes after the US administration said President Joe Biden defended the open “diplomacy with North Korea about denounciation.

“Diplomacy has compiled a false document to the United States that should cover their hostile deeds”, the North Korean Foreign Ministry said in a statement broadcast by the KCNA agency.

At the same time, President Joe Biden is warned that he made a big <x0 malpractice “with his outdated “ ” attitude towards North Korea.

In a separate statement also issued by the KCNA, the northeastern ministry accused US President of insulting Kim Jong Un, adding: “We have warned the US that they can understand how it will be harmed if it provokes”.

On Wednesday, Joe Biden told Congress that “diplomacy and sharp prevention would limit Pyongyang's nuclear ambitions.

US “North Korean Policy will be cautious, practical and open to diplomacy”, White House spokeswoman Jen Psaki told reporters on Friday.

Our “objective remains the complete de-launchation of the Korean Peninsula”, she added.

Our “Policy will not focus on the search for a big job”, she noted, clearly showing a change of approach to Donald Trump's policy.

On April 21st, South Korean President Moon Yae called on Joe Biden to start negotiations with Pyongyang.

The most important thing for both governments is to be ready for dialogue and to sit down together as soon as possible”, said Moon, who is scheduled to meet with the US president at the White House on 21 May.

Negotiations between the United States and North Korea have stalled following the failure of the second summit attended by Donald Trump and Kim Jong Un in Hanoi in February 2019 and Pyongyang continued its missile tests.
